Download Solution PDFThe correct answer is - One curriculum for all students
Key Points
- One curriculum for all students
- An inclusive curriculum ensures that all students, regardless of their abilities or disabilities, learn from the same curriculum.
- This approach promotes equity and accessibility in education.
- It aims to address the diverse learning needs of all students through differentiated instruction and universal design for learning (UDL).
Additional Information
- Differentiated Instruction
- Teachers modify their teaching methods and materials to meet the varied needs of their students.
- This can include providing additional support, varying the difficulty level of tasks, or using different modes of instruction.
- Universal Design for Learning (UDL)
- An educational framework that guides the development of flexible learning environments.
- Aims to accommodate individual learning differences by providing multiple means of representation, expression, and engagement.
- Benefits of an Inclusive Curriculum
- Promotes a sense of belonging and community among all students.
- Prepares students for a diverse society by fostering understanding and respect for differences.
- Encourages higher expectations and academic outcomes for all students.
